首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Axios后成功执行api时捕获错误

在Axios后成功执行API时捕获错误,可以通过以下步骤实现:

  1. 首先,确保已经安装了Axios库,并在项目中引入它。
  2. 在需要执行API请求的地方,使用Axios发送请求。例如,使用GET方法请求一个API:
代码语言:txt
复制
import axios from 'axios';

axios.get('https://api.example.com/data')
  .then(response => {
    // 在请求成功时执行的操作
    console.log(response.data);
  })
  .catch(error => {
    // 在请求失败时执行的操作
    console.error(error);
  });
  1. 在上述代码中,.then()用于处理请求成功的情况,.catch()用于处理请求失败的情况。在.catch()中,可以通过error参数来获取错误信息。
  2. 如果需要在请求失败时执行特定的操作,可以在.catch()中添加相应的代码。例如,可以显示一个错误提示或者进行其他处理。
  3. 如果需要在请求成功和失败时执行相同的操作,可以使用.finally()方法。例如,可以在请求结束后隐藏加载动画。

这样,当Axios成功执行API请求时,会执行.then()中的代码;当请求失败时,会执行.catch()中的代码,并且可以通过error参数获取错误信息。

对于Axios的更多详细信息和用法,请参考腾讯云的相关产品和文档:

  • 腾讯云产品:云服务器(CVM)
  • 产品介绍链接地址:https://cloud.tencent.com/product/cvm
  • 文档链接地址:https://cloud.tencent.com/document/product/213
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券